Which of the following children requires a child restraint system?
A. A six-year old weighing 70 pounds
B. A five-year old weighing 55 pounds
C. A five-year old weighing 65 pounds - ✔✔B. A five-year old weighing 55 pounds
It is very foggy. Slow down, turn on your windshield wipers and:
A. High beam lights
B. Low beam lights
C. Emergency flashers - ✔✔B. Low beam lights
To see vehicles in your blind spots, you must:
A. Turn your head
B. Look in your side mirrors
C. Look in your inside rearview mirror - ✔✔A. Turn your head
Which of the following is true about safety belts and collisions
A. They are unnecessary for vehicles equipped with front or side air bags
B. They keep you from being thrown clear to safety, which lowers your chances of surviving collisions
C. They increase your chances of survival in most types of collisions - ✔✔C. They increase your chances
of survival in most types of collisions
Smoking inside a vehicle when a person younger than 18 years of age is present is
A. Legal, if it is your child
B. Illegal at all times
C. Not restricted by law - ✔✔B. Illegal at all times
When driving near road construction zones, you should:
A. Slow down to watch the construction as you pass
, B. Step on your brakes just before you pass the construction
C. Reduce speed and be prepared to stop - ✔✔C. Reduce speed and be prepared to stop
This yellow sign means: (diamond sign, 1 straight black line, 1 crooked black line with a dashed black line
that ends when the solid line takes it's place)
A. Less space between the lanes ahead
B. The highway will be divided ahead
C. The right lane will end ahead - ✔✔C. The right lane will end ahead
Who has the right-of-way at an intersection with no cross walks?
A. Pedestrians always have the right-of-way
B. Vehicles, but they should slow down and be careful
C. Pedestrians, but only with the green "WALK" signal - ✔✔A. Pedestrians always have the right-of-way
You are crossing an intersection and an emergency vehicle is approaching with a siren and flashing lights.
You should:
A. Stop immediately in the intersection until it passes
B. Pull to the right in the intersection and stop
C. Continue through the intersection, pull to the right, and stop - ✔✔C. Continue through the
intersection, pull to the right, and stop
You can be fined up to $1,000 and jailed for six months if you are cited for:
A. Dumping or abandoning an animal on a highway
B. Making a U-turn from a center left-lane
C. Parking in the bicycle lane - ✔✔A. Dumping or abandoning an animal on a highway
You must carefully watch for bicycles in traffic lanes because they:
A. Must ride facing oncoming traffic
B. Could be hidden in your blind spots
C. Usually have the right-of-way - ✔✔B. Could be hidden in your blind spots
